Abstract

An error appeared in Fig. 1 of the article, which appeared in AIDS, volume 22, issue 2 [1].Fig. 1: Kaplan–Meier estimates of time to loss of virological response (< 400 copies/ml): randomized patients on initial therapy. Subjects considered to have reached the study endpoint at first virological rebound, change in antiretroviral therapy, or death. Subjects who remained in response at the time of discontinuation were censored at the date of their last on-study HIV-RNA measurement. Subjects who did not respond to initial treatment were considered to have reached the endpoint at time zero. Treatmentefavirenz, zidovudine plus lamivudine (EFV+ ZDV+ 3TC; N = 422);indinavir, zidovudine plus lamivudine (IDV+ZDV+3TC; N=415);efavirenz plus indinavir (EFV + IDV; N = 429).In Fig. 1, the legend on the bottom is incorrect. The bottom and middle lines on the graph were incorrectly labeled, and the last sentence of the legend should have read: Treatment efavirenz, zidovudine plus lamivudine (EFV+ ZDV+ 3TC; N= 422); indinavir, zidovudine plus lamivudine (IDV+ZDV+3TC; N = 415); efavirenz plus indinavir (EFV + IDV; N = 429). The corrected figure legend with the figure appears below.
